According to DL News, the possibility of Trump creating a national Bitcoin reserve was a major factor in driving the cryptocurrency market to new heights. Now, the momentum of strategic Bitcoin reserves in the United States is seeping down to state level, for example:
Florida is taking steps to establish its strategic Bitcoin reserve as early as the first quarter of 2025;
Pennsylvania is still formulating its own Bitcoin strategic reserve bill, which was launched in November and is expected to invest 10% of the state's general fund in Bitcoin;
The goal of Florida and Pennsylvania is to directly purchase Bitcoins, but other states like Michigan and Wisconsin have chosen a more conservative route by investing in ETFs and trust funds related to Bitcoin:
SEC filings show that as of September, Michigan held $11 million worth of ARK 21Shares Bitcoin ETF;
Wisconsin Investment Committee holds over $220 million worth Grayscale and BlackRock's bitcoin ETF stocks.
